def test_role_parenting(db):
    OrganizationalUnit = utils.get_ou_model()
    Role = utils.get_role_model()
    RoleParenting = utils.get_role_parenting_model()

    ou = OrganizationalUnit.objects.create(name='ou')
    roles = []
    for i in range(10):
        roles.append(Role.objects.create(name='r%d' % i, ou=ou))

    assert Role.objects.count() == 10
    assert RoleParenting.objects.count() == 0
    for i in range(1, 3):
        RoleParenting.objects.create(parent=roles[i - 1], child=roles[i])
    assert RoleParenting.objects.filter(direct=True).count() == 2
    assert RoleParenting.objects.filter(direct=False).count() == 1
    for i, role in enumerate(roles[:3]):
        assert role.children().count() == 3 - i
        assert role.parents().count() == i + 1
        assert role.children(False).count() == 3 - i - 1
        assert role.parents(False).count() == i

    for i in range(4, 6):
        RoleParenting.objects.create(parent=roles[i - 1], child=roles[i])
    assert RoleParenting.objects.filter(direct=True).count() == 4
    assert RoleParenting.objects.filter(direct=False).count() == 2
    for i, role in enumerate(roles[3:6]):
        assert role.children().count() == 3 - i
        assert role.parents().count() == i + 1
        assert role.children(False).count() == 3 - i - 1
        assert role.parents(False).count() == i
    RoleParenting.objects.create(parent=roles[2], child=roles[3])
    assert RoleParenting.objects.filter(direct=True).count() == 5
    assert RoleParenting.objects.filter(direct=False).count() == 10
    for i in range(6):
        assert roles[i].parents().distinct().count() == i + 1
    for i, role in enumerate(roles[:6]):
        assert role.children().count() == 6 - i
        assert role.parents().count() == i + 1
        assert role.children(False).count() == 6 - i - 1
        assert role.parents(False).count() == i
    RoleParenting.objects.filter(parent=roles[2], child=roles[3],
                                 direct=True).delete()
    assert RoleParenting.objects.filter(direct=True).count() == 4
    assert RoleParenting.objects.filter(direct=False).count() == 2
    # test that it works with cycles
    RoleParenting.objects.create(parent=roles[2], child=roles[3])
    RoleParenting.objects.create(parent=roles[5], child=roles[0])
    for role in roles[:6]:
        assert role.children().count() == 6
        assert role.parents().count() == 6

    def parentings(self):
        """ Update parentings (delete everything then create)
        """
        created, deleted = [], []
        Parenting = get_role_parenting_model()
        for parenting in Parenting.objects.filter(child=self._obj,
                                                  direct=True):
            parenting.delete()
            deleted.append(parenting)

        if self._parents:
            for parent_d in self._parents:
                parent = search_role(parent_d)
                if not parent:
                    raise DataImportError("Could not find role : %s" %
                                          parent_d)
                created.append(
                    Parenting.objects.create(child=self._obj,
                                             direct=True,
                                             parent=parent))

        return created, deleted
